Understanding AI Chatbots in Academic Conferences
AI chatbots are intelligent virtual assistants powered by artificial intelligence, natural language processing, and machine learning. In academic conferences, these chatbots are integrated into websites, registration portals, mobile apps, and messaging platforms to provide real-time support and information.
Unlike static FAQs or manual helpdesks, The chatbots learn from interactions, respond instantly, and operate continuously, making them highly effective for large and time-sensitive academic events.
Increased Adoption Across Conference Stages
By 2026, AI chatbots are no longer limited to attendee support during the event. They are actively used before, during, and after conferences. From answering submission-related queries to post-event feedback collection, chatbots cover the entire conference lifecycle.
Integration with Conference Management Systems
AI chatbots are increasingly integrated with abstract submission systems, reviewer management tools, registration platforms, and scheduling software. This integration allows chatbots to provide accurate, context-aware responses based on real-time data.
Personalized Academic Experiences
One major trend in 2026 is personalization. AI chatbots analyze attendee interests, research domains, and session history to recommend relevant presentations, workshops, and networking opportunities, creating a more tailored conference experience.
Multilingual and Inclusive Support
With growing international participation, AI chatbots are becoming multilingual, enabling conferences to communicate effectively with diverse audiences and improve accessibility for global researchers.
1. Conference Organizers
AI chatbots significantly reduce administrative workload by handling repetitive queries related to registration, schedules, submission deadlines, and venue logistics. This allows organizers to focus on strategic planning and academic quality.
2. Authors and Researchers
For authors, AI chatbots provide instant guidance on abstract and paper submission guidelines, formatting rules, and submission status updates. This improves clarity and reduces confusion during critical submission periods.
3. Reviewers and Committees
Reviewers benefit from automated reminders, easy access to instructions, and quick answers to procedural questions. Program committees can rely on chatbots to streamline communication and improve response times.
4. Impact on Attendees
Attendees enjoy real-time assistance for session navigation, speaker details, venue directions, and schedule changes. Chatbots help create a smoother and more engaging conference journey.
